The Manufacture of Fibre Optic Cables Sector in Poland has shown a robust growth trajectory from 2013 to 2023, with a notable uptick in employment figures, peaking at a 29.97% year-on-year growth in 2019. The compound annual growth rate (CAGR) demonstrates a consistent upward trend, peaking at 16.95% between 2018 and 2019, before stabilizing to a forecasted 5-year CAGR of 5.74% towards 2028. The employment sector is expected to expand by 32.22% in the next five years, indicating sustained, albeit slower, growth.
Looking ahead, key trends to monitor include technological advancements in fibre optic technology, shifts in global supply chain dynamics, and domestic investments in telecommunications infrastructure, all of which could significantly influence employment trends in this sector.
